titleOfInvention |
Process for producing propylene-ethylene block copolymer |
abstract |
A propylene-ethylene block copolymer is produced in the presence of a catalytic system essentially comprising an organoaluminum compound and a solid titanium trichloride catalytic complex having an atomic ratio of Al to Ti of less than 0.15 and having a complexing agent in two stages of polymerization; (a) a first stage for polymerizing propylene in the presence of a liquid propylene and hydrogen to produce a propylene homopolymer having a melt flow index of 1 to 150 at a ratio of 70 to 95% by weight based on a total of polymers; and (b) a second stage for copolymerizing propylene and ethylene in the presence of hydrogen and a liquid propylene at a concentration of propylene in vapor phase based on a total of propylene and ethylene in vapor phase of 50 to 85 mol. % and at a concentration of hydrogen in vapor phase based on a total of propylene and ethylene in vapor phase of 0.5 to 30 mol %, to produce ethylene-propylene copolymer having a melt flow index of 10-7 to 0.1 at a ratio of 5 to 30% by weight based on a total of polymers. |
